A solar cell is not an energy source, but an energy converter. In the case of solar, the energy source is light, and the solar cell converts it from light energy to electrical energy.
One difference is that the solar cell has no moving parts, while the mirror method (concentrated solar) has moving parts in its turbines.Photoelectric Voltaic Cell (PV)When the sun shines on a solar cell it knocks electrons loose from the atoms in the silicon cell. These electrons are captured in the form of an electric current, that is, electricity.Concentrated Solar CollectionMirrors and lenses focus the sun's heat onto a container of water, or salt. This extremely hot material is then used to spin electricity generators to produce electricity.
Photovoltaic energy is the conversion of sunlight into electricity. A photovoltaic cell, commonly called a solar cell or PV, is the technology used to convert solar energy directly into electrical power. A photovoltaic cell is a nonmechanical device usually made from silicon alloys. When light strikes these silicon alloys, it frees electrons which can be collected onto attached conductive plates.

In a crystalline solar electric panel, the light of the sun interacts with a semiconductor material (usually silicon) in the PV cell to free electrons and produce an electric current.
